SRM are supporting a scaling manufacturing and engineering services business in the Greater Oxford area to recruit a Financial Controller
.
This role is a "hands on, process improvement" centred role and are looking for a qualified accountant (ACA / CA preferred; however, strong candidates with alternative qualifications will be considered). T his is an office based role, 5 days a week but working in a collaborative, supportive culture.
Key responsibilities:
- Ledger Management and Monthly Reporting – leading and end-to-end month-end close process on a timely basis and to support accurate and relevant Board reporting and department requirements. From a process improvement perspective, our client would like a candidate who sees issues and can improve processes - develop month end reporting to ensure visibility and control of all areas of the business.
Ensure completion of balance sheet reconciliations. - Lead, Manage and Develop Operational Finance Team – lead, manage and small finance team (6) to ensure smooth running of payment, accounting and reporting functions.
- Budgeting & Forecasting – assist in preparing the annual budget, mid-year reforecasts, and five-year business plans with specific input on opening position, overheads, structure companies, tax and balance sheet items.
- Cost Control & Profitability – supervise the preparation of monthly cost and commitment reporting to support review and re-forecast of engineering project spend/cost, technical fees etc. Lead cost reviews with budget holders, and work with department heads to ensure dates per the monthly site tracker are accurate.
- Statutory Reporting & Audit – act as lead contact for auditors and tax advisers during the year-end audit; prepare year-end statutory accounts and tax workbooks; co-ordinate final submissions to Companies House and HMRC.
- Taxation & Compliance – oversee preparation of VAT returns, liaise with tax advisors and manage compliance with payroll, P11
Ds, and other statutory requirements. - Payroll Preparation and Submission - manage and support collation of information and evidence by HR Admin for payroll submission.
- Internal Controls & Process Improvement – champion adherence to policies, drive internal controls, and proactively identify opportunities for efficiency gains
